Choosing a Anderson Moving Company

Different types of moves work best with different movers. The first step in choosing a moving company is determining whether a local or national company is best. You'll also need to decide if you require a full-service or self-service moving company. If you hate packing boxes, you will probably want to employ a full-service company that offers packing services. If you don't mind doing your own packing, you might instead go with a self-service mover, which will supply a truck and driver but not packing assistance.

Next, you can look to see which movers near you meet the licensing requirements for movers in Indiana. You can also read online reviews and look at the company's rating on the BBB. All of the companies on our list of Anderson's best movers are well-reviewed and selected by our team of experts.

Once you've narrowed it down to a few companies, you can start reaching out to them. We suggest reaching out to two or more of the moving companies from our list above. Make sure to explain all the services you need when asking for an estimate. Also, check that they've given you a "binding estimate" — otherwise, the actual cost may be subject to change.

How Much Do Movers in Anderson Cost?

Something that most people worry about when moving is the cost. In Anderson, the typical hourly cost for movers is:

  • Average: $47 per hour
  • Range: $38 to $56 per hour
The amount you can expect to spend on moving can also be estimated by home size. The typical cost to move homes of various sizes in Anderson is:
  • One bedroom: Between $378 and $562
  • Two bedrooms: Between $567 and $843
  • Three bedrooms: Between $851 and $1,265

A few signs that you shouldn't use a specific mover include:

  • The company avoids questions about its credentials and insurance coverage.
  • The company offers discounts, promotions, or quotes that sound too good to be true.
  • The company can't provide you with references.
  • The company demands that you pay upfront.
  • The company has complaints against them at the Better Business Bureau or Federal Motor Carrier Safety Agency.
